Abstract :
The digital divide is a term often used to describe differences between rich and poor communities. This term however is more encompassing than that, as it relates to the divide between those who have access to information and communication technologies (ICTs) and those who don´t. Due to the small screen size, and resulting small font size and low contrast supported by most mobile phones, the visually impaired community fall into this category of having little access to this popular ICT. This paper presents iCanSee, a SIM based application built on a smart card Web server (SCWS), developed particularly for the visually impaired community. It provides a Web-based front end to the four most frequently used text-based communication tools on a mobile phone: the phone book; SMS; MMS; and email. iCanSee allows users to create their own CSS profiles, supporting changes to: background and font colour (for contrast); and font size. As the CSS file is stored on the SIM rather than the handset itself, when the user upgrades to a new mobile handset, all their settings are transferred along with other personal information such as their address book.
